.paragraph-teaser .gr-grid{display:grid;grid-auto-flow:row}@media(min-width: 700px){.paragraph-teaser .gr-grid{grid-auto-rows:1fr}}@media(min-width: 1900px){.paragraph-teaser .gr-grid{grid-template-columns:repeat(4, minmax(0, 1fr));row-gap:2.5rem;-moz-column-gap:2.5rem;column-gap:2.5rem}}@media(min-width: 1360px)and (max-width: 1899px){.paragraph-teaser .gr-grid{grid-template-columns:repeat(3, minmax(0, 1fr));row-gap:1.5rem;-moz-column-gap:1.5rem;column-gap:1.5rem}}@media(min-width: 700px)and (max-width: 1359px){.paragraph-teaser .gr-grid{grid-template-columns:repeat(2, minmax(0, 1fr))}}@media(max-width: 699px){.paragraph-teaser .gr-grid{grid-template-columns:repeat(1, minmax(0, 1fr))}}@media(max-width: 1359px){.paragraph-teaser .gr-grid{row-gap:1rem;-moz-column-gap:1rem;column-gap:1rem}}@media(max-width: 1359px){.paragraph-teaser h2{margin-bottom:1rem}}@media(min-width: 1360px){.paragraph-teaser h2{margin-bottom:0}}@media(min-width: 700px){.paragraph-teaser__heading{margin-bottom:2.5rem}}@media(max-width: 699px){.paragraph-teaser__heading{margin-bottom:1.5rem}}@media(min-width: 1360px){.paragraph-teaser__button{text-align:right}.paragraph-teaser__button .button{text-align:left}}.campus-locations__list{display:flex;flex-wrap:wrap;margin-top:1rem;margin-bottom:0;padding:0}.campus-locations__list li{margin-bottom:0}.campus-locations__list li:not(:last-child){margin-right:1.5rem}.campus-locations__link{margin:0 0 0 0;font-weight:600;font-size:1.25rem;line-height:1.75rem;word-break:break-word;overflow-wrap:break-word;-ms-hyphens:auto;hyphens:auto;position:relative;display:flex;align-items:center;color:#005d92;text-decoration:none}@media(min-width: 700px)and (max-width: 1359px){.campus-locations__link{margin:0 0 0 0}}@media(min-width: 1360px)and (max-width: 1899px){.campus-locations__link{margin:0 0 0 0}}@media(min-width: 1360px){.campus-locations__link{font-size:1.5rem;line-height:2rem}}@media(min-width: 1900px){.campus-locations__link{margin:0 0 0 0}}.campus-locations__link a:not(.link){color:inherit;text-decoration:none}.campus-locations__link:hover{color:#005d92}.campus-locations__link .icon-hbrs-map{position:relative;display:flex;justify-content:center;width:2rem;height:2rem;margin-right:.5rem;border-radius:50%;background-color:#005d92}.campus-locations__link .icon-hbrs-map::before{position:absolute;right:unset;z-index:2;color:#d8f3ff !important;font-size:1.25rem}
